Socioeconomic and Environmental Sustainability

The  Professional Master's in Socioeconomic Environmental Sustainability (Programa de Pós-Graduação em Sustentabilidade Socioeconômica Ambiental - PPGSSA)  contributes to the formation of highly qualified professionals, capable of relating theoretical and applied knowledge in the challenging search for sustainability.

The program aims to provide excellence training to higher level professionals who work at the public sphere, at research and development centers, teaching institutions, companies, and non-governmental institutions. It is aimed at students graduated from the Engineering Sciences, Geology, Chemistry, Biology, and related areas, with Environmental Socioeconomic Sustainability backgrounds.

This program offers two concentration areas, namely: 1) Governance, Legislation, Economics, and Policies for Sustainability and 2) Environmental assessment and sustainable use of natural resources. Under the first area, are the following lines of research: a) Water and Genres; b) Communities and Social Ecology; c) Environmental Management and Sustainability, and d) Valuation of environmental Services. The second area covers the following lines of research: a) Areas Degraded by Miner-Metallurgical Industry; b) Energy and Sustainability; c) Environmental Geochemistry and Medical Geology; d) Hydrographic Basin Management; e) Hydrographic basin management, Pluri-sources Energy, Economy integrated with Ecology; ) f) Forest Industrialization; and g) Environmental Sanitation Technologies.
